Beloved son of Melville and Marion Finlayson of Elmhurst, Illinois. Cherished brother of Marnie, Duncan, Jane Constance, Helen Estelle, Nancy, James (Donald), Dorothy, Margaret and Charlotte Patricia (Patsy) Finlayson.
Loving husband of Margaret J. "Peg" Gudgeon Cooper and devoted father to Lynn and Lori, as well as many grandchildren. Doug and Peg married on October 19, 1963 at St. Lucy's Catholic Church in Chicago.
Doug was a Veteran of WWII in the US Army Air Force Corps. Doug's name is engraved on the War Memorial in Wilder Park in Elmhurst.
